What is the most aerodynamic curve?

For speeds lower than the speed of sound, the most aerodynamically efficient shape is the teardrop. The teardrop has a rounded nose that tapers as it moves backward, forming a narrow, yet rounded tail, which gradually brings the air around the object back together instead of creating eddy currents.

What shape has the highest drag?

Effect of Shape on Drag

A quick comparison shows that a flat plate gives the highest drag, and a streamlined symmetric airfoil gives the lowest drag, by a factor of almost 30!

What is the fastest aerodynamic shape?

The most aerodynamic shape in nature is a teardrop, it has a drag coefficient (Cd) of 0.04. This is the reason why so many aerodynamically efficient cars often look like a well-used bar of soap.

Why aren t cars teardrop shaped?

Cars need to be designed with many factors in mind, such as passenger and cargo space, safety, and aesthetics. Additionally, teardrop shapes can be difficult to manufacture and can limit visibility for the driver.

What shape can take the most force?

There are several shapes that are used when strength is important. The arc (think: circle) is the strongest structural shape, and in nature, the sphere is the strongest 3-d shape. The reason being is that stress is distributed equally along the arc instead of concentrating at any one point.
